THE WOODLANDS, TX -- As the week progresses Montgomery County Office of Homeland Security and Emergency Management will monitor the changing weather. We can expect to continue to have rounds of severe thunderstorms, most of which will produce high rainfall rates. Be prepared for some flash flooding on roadways, remember to use extreme caution when driving. Currently our rivers and creeks remain below flood stage, we will continue to monitor conditions.
Severe Thunderstorm Warning is in Effect for Southeast Montgomery County until 3:45 PM.
(This Could be extended.)

Please be weather aware as you go through the week and pay close attention to National Weather Alerts watches and warnings.
